Utilization of micropreparative fast focusing by a new wide pH range electrolyte system based on bidirectional isotachophoresis
Vykydalová, Marie ; Duša, Filip ; Horká, Marie ; Šlais, Karel
We suggest the possibility of practical utilization of a new electrolyte system for fast preparative focusing in wide pH range based on bidirectional isotachophoresis. The focusing occurs on nonwoven fabric strip positioned in an open horizontal V-shaped trough. It is based on bidirectional ITP with multiple counter ions and spacers created from commercially available simple buffers. Milk spiked with ampicillin was used as a sample and high performance liquid chromatography was as a second dimension for analysis of fast preparative focusing fractions. Speed, easy fraction handling, and possibility of pre-concentration of analytes from a raw sample are the benefits of this technique.
